Historically, the cry of "Jago" (Wake up) was reserved for specific religious occasions, particularly Jagrans (all-night vigils) dedicated to the Goddess Durga (Sherawali). The transition of this phrase into a 30-second digital loop represents a shift from temporal specificity (used only at dawn or during festivals) to asynchronous availability (accessible at any moment via a phone call). jago jago sherawali savera ho gaya ringtone
